Why does cnet hire people who know nothing about tvs to talk about tvs. The Samsung is a QD OLED panel which uses blue light and quantum dots to produce colors so it has a better color volume than the LG. The LG uses white light along with a 4 stack tandem to improve color it has less color volume than the Samsung TV but white does look better on it. FYI Samsung stepdown model the S90H uses a LG WOLED panel and this model the Samsung S95h uses the samsung QD OLED panel.

@robertvandenberg3998Does CNET not have proper editorial. How are you incorrectly stating that the LG G6 is a two-stack tandem when it is a 4 stack tandem, and those vents on the S95H are not for cooling, they are speakers. Also that CIE chart looks like the TV is clearly in DCI P3 and you're measuring 709? Of course its going to be inaccurate when you put the TV in the wrong mode, samsungs come out of the box in auto and RTINGs have it at a pre calibration score of 0.83 which is insane and has been corroborated by other reviewers. This just appears to make the TV look as bad as possible. The real answer is SDR = G6 HDR = S95/S99H Also want to add that the way you are doing that light test is completely favoured to the LG. You are covering the shine of your flashlight with your phone being straight on vs on the samsung you're doing it at an angle. The G6 anti reflect is really damn good this year, but going out of your way to make it look better by covering the reflection of the light with the phone is kinda odd, and then having the phone at an angle for the samsung is also odd.
